windscreen cover recall

Took my civic back to the honda for the recall at weekend and they asked me if i wanted the windcreen cover guard doing as that also on recall. Dont know what they actually done . Has anyone else had this done and what was the faualt . stupid never asked

I think this is the one that it was rubbing away at the paint work under the seal and casing it to come off, so in time you would get rust forming so they have changed it

I had mine done. It's the top strip. It can come loose and mark the roof.
